Output d3693e88de43fd02a55ef2e55bafe4e2898aec2376a26e2bd26acc95b0705f26:0

value
20764
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77cc831ddad13ebed277df53b715fb6773a7bdd5a109950f07fef6ce9849773f
address
bc1pwlxgx8w66ylta5nhmafmw90mvae600w45yye2rc8lmmvaxzfwuls99veah
transaction
d3693e88de43fd02a55ef2e55bafe4e2898aec2376a26e2bd26acc95b0705f26
confirmations
52420
spent
true